Top 3 Best Colonial Beach Public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 992 students in Colonial Beach, VA (there are , serving 8 private students). 99% of all K-12 students in Colonial Beach, VA are educated in public schools (compared to the VA state average of 89%).
The top ranked public schools in Colonial Beach, VA are Colonial Beach High School, Colonial Beach Elementary School and Washington District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Colonial Beach, VA public schools have an average math proficiency score of 38% (versus the Virginia public school average of 54%), and reading proficiency score of 62% (versus the 70% statewide average). Schools in Colonial Beach have an average ranking of 2/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Virginia public schools.
Minority enrollment is 44%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Virginia public school average of 56% (majority Black and Hispanic).
